This sweet boy is Arthur; he is a special soul with the best energy and a very kind heart. He is blind and deaf, and a senior. Artie is very smart and independent, and he learns the home and yard impressively quickly. He is going to fill a very lucky home with so much love. His presence brings a great big smile to everyone that meets him. Arthur is a 60 pound, Senior Staffy Mix with beautiful brindle markings and a very lovable smile. He is house trained and crate trained, and he is up to date on shots. His adoption fee is $175. To adopt Arthur apply here.
